Information Systems is a fast-expanding industry and the point where business studies and information technology meet. Information systems are a major part of many organisations and impact business operations on a day-to-day basis through mobile phones, EFTPOS, news, and the internet. As a result there has been an increasing demand for 'tech-savvy' people to create and run these systems.
UC's Master of Business Information Systems (MBIS) aims to address high-level skills shortages in the rapidly growing ICT industry, and to meet the growing demand for work-ready graduates in Aotearoa New Zealand and abroad. The MBIS equips graduates, including those from a non-Information Systems or Commerce background, with specialist knowledge and skills applicable to managing the use of technology and technology-driven innovations in business.
The MBIS sits within the Business Taught Masters programme as part of a suite of taught master’s degrees that cater for graduates with a background in an unrelated field.
Why study a Master of Business Information Systems at UC?To enter the MBIS you will need to have completed previous bachelor's study in Aotearoa New Zealand with at least a B- Grade Point Average in your 300-level courses (or other approved equivalent degrees).
